Mahindra XUV700 MX & AX trims detailed in an official video

Mahindra just unveiled the XUV 700 for the Indian market. Everyone was shocked by the pricing of the SUV. The base variant of the XUV 700 starts at just Rs. 11.99 lakhs ex-showroom. As of now, three variants of the SUV has been unveiled. There is MX, AX3 and AX5. As of now, the prices and variants of only the 5-seater version have been announced. Mahindra has released official videos on their YouTube channel that shows what does each variant offers.

MX 

First, is the MX variant which is the base variant of the SUV. It will come with an 8-inch touchscreen infotainment system which is a new generation. It comes with Android Auto and Apple CarPlay. It gets an analogue tachometer and speedometer with a 7-inch multi-information display in between. It also gets a multi-function steering wheel that houses controls for the infotainment system. Mahindra is offering LED tail lamps as standard and smart door handles. The outside rearview mirrors get an electric adjustment and have an LED turn indicators on them.

Mahindra will offer the MX variant with a petrol engine and a diesel engine. The petrol engine will produce 200 PS of max power and 380 Nm of peak torque. The diesel engine will be offered in a lower state of tune. It will produce 155 PS of max power and 360 Nm of peak torque. The petrol engine is priced at Rs. 11.99 lakhs ex-showroom while the diesel engine is priced at Rs. 12.49 lakhs ex-showroom.

AX3

Then there is the mid-spec AX3 variant. It will come with a larger 10.25-inch touchscreen infotainment system that runs on AdrenoX and gets 60+ connected features. The infotainment system supports wireless Android Auto, Apple CarPlay and Amazon Alexa. It is connected to 6 speakers with sound staging. Mahindra also offers LED Daytime Running Lamps and fog lamps. There are no alloy wheels on offer with this variant. Instead, you get 17-inch steel wheels with wheel covers. It also comes with a 10.25-inch digital instrument cluster.

It is available with the same 200 horsepower petrol engine and the diesel engine which is in a higher state of tune. It puts out 185 PS of max power and a peak torque output of 420 Nm if you get the manual gearbox and if you get the automatic gearbox then the torque output is increased to 450 Nm. The petrol engine costs Rs. 13.99 lakhs ex-showroom and the price of the diesel engine has not been announced.

AX5

As of now, the AX5 is the highest variant that has been announced by Mahindra. It comes with a panoramic sunroof, 17-inch diamond-cut alloy wheels, LED headlamps, sequential turn indicators and cornering lamps. It will also come with a petrol engine and a diesel engine. However, the price of only the petrol engine has been announced. It costs Rs. 14.99 lakhs ex-showroom.

AX7

We are expecting that Mahindra will also launch an AX7 variant of the XUV 700. It will come with ADAS or Advanced Driver Aids System, Sony sound system, memory seats, 360-degree camera, 18-inch alloy wheels and an optional all-wheel-drive system.
